Transaction 4a9465790658604ff256b497050a0ad86765a28150b77383ffc367ae4b36aac4
1 Input
1 Output
-
4a9465790658604ff256b497050a0ad86765a28150b77383ffc367ae4b36aac4:0
- value
- 155489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 189b657986a6ece7dda715e14fa947e5a4e7a506 OP_EQUAL
- address
- 33w8JH4un564uT6EDwj5zan3qgj4VpDkUK